2012 की एक अमेरिकी अलौकिक हॉरर फिल्म है, जिसे ओले बोर्नडल ने डायरेक्ट किया था। इस फिल्म को हॉरर फिल्मों के मशहूर निर्देशक सैम राइमी (जिन्होंने स्पाइडर-मैन और डेड विले जैसी फिल्मों को डायरेक्ट किया) ने प्रोड्यूस किया था। फिल्म की राइटिंग जूलियट स्नोडेन और स्टाइल्स व्हाइट ने की थी। यह 31 अगस्त 2012 को अमेरिका में रिलीज़ हुई और भारत में इसे 5 अक्टूबर 2012 को रिलीज़ किया गया था ।

As Emily opens the box and releases the entity, her behavior becomes erratic. She speaks in guttural voices, develops an aversion to light and food, and begins to exhibit superhuman strength. The family, initially dismissing it as a psychological issue, finds themselves in a race against time. They consult a Hasidic Jewish scholar, Tzadok (Matisyahu), who explains that the dybbuk is not just a ghost—it is a parasitic soul that will consume its host entirely. The film claims to be "based on a true story," specifically inspired by a 2004 Los Angeles Times article titled "A Jinx in a Box?".
